Home Office fire safety EEIS consulation response

The NFA has responded to the Home Office’s consultation on the Emergency Evacuation Information Sharing (EEIS) proposals. This follows the Home Office’s decision to not introduce Personal Emergency Evacuation Plans (PEEPs) to social housing at this time. 

Overall, we agree that the new EEIS proposal focusing initially on the buildings with the greatest fire safety risk is the right approach at this time. We also welcome the proposals to develop a toolkit to support Responsible Persons to fulfill their duties under the Regulatory Reform (Fire Safety) Order 2005 which we believe will help spread good practice across the country.
